You're getting lots of input . . . so I'll maybe try to come from a different perspective.
3/4 acre is a size . . not a measurement of need or use. Getting a scut, regardless of brand, is an economic decision first. Can you afford such an item? Now in the group of responders you'll get many who have owned many tractors. Those opinions may conflict with someone who never owned one . . because they can't imagine not having one. The same is true because of cost. You can buy a used rider for $1000 or less . . but not a scut. The opinions of those with more money is vastly different than someone who has little money.
So lets look from your perspective of use (not desire). Ask yourself:
A. Does my yard need or require 4wd? If it doesn't then also consider lawn mowers with a rear pto.
B. Do you plan to do front end loader activities often or will it be just once a year. Once a year might mean renting a Dingo unit instead.
C. Do you have a big driveway and sidewalks?
D. Can you afford a scut . . either new or used? I don't mean 60 payments or cash . . I mean do you have excess cash flow or are you borrowed up to your socks?
